VIPERGAN100 Series

The VIPERGAN100 is a high voltage converter, designed for medium power quasi-resonant ZVS (Zero Voltage Switching at switch turn-on) flyback converters, capable to provide an output power up to 75 W in wide range and up to 100 W in European range or with a PFC in the front end.

It integrates a complete set of features that provide an extremely flexible and easy to use chip and helps to design a highly efficient offline power supply. The ZVS quasi-resonant operation with the dynamic blanking time feature and the valley synchronization function, that turns on the power switch always at the valley of the drain resonance, reduces the switching losses and maximizes the overall efficiency at any input line and load condition. The advanced power management with the low quiescent helps to achieve low stand-by consumptions. The feed-forward compensation minimizes the maximum output peak power variation over the entire input voltage range.

In addition to the above functions, the device offers protection features that considerably increase end-product’s safety and reliability: the output overvoltage protection (OVP), the overtemperature protection (OTP), the overload protection (OLP), the brown-in/out protection, that set the input voltage level to power on and power off the converter and the input overvoltage protection (iOVP), that protects the system in case of an abnormal increase of the input line. All the protections are auto-restart mode.
